Output bb686cf72c713ad00343628ce5073091161d6df37188319067ed20005ede20e3:1

value
3585515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c20b628ae4e29d6085dca8a0a85d4b57875d09 OP_EQUAL
address
3CRfSS8xkHpvwqCaynP8yj8cdiVgkxKRqw
transaction
bb686cf72c713ad00343628ce5073091161d6df37188319067ed20005ede20e3
spent
true